Output dfbbb21e4629b51ca33d5200b13e4e75bee622f58ba0718e36d54454ea542249:1

value
2087600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0858d13a8770955b8b8b5b00fbe5e7eb0140a3c0 OP_EQUALVERIFY OP_CHECKSIG
address
1m8ofnocPgi4FGikCVNtPFuqqx3UU5bFx
transaction
dfbbb21e4629b51ca33d5200b13e4e75bee622f58ba0718e36d54454ea542249
confirmations
327351
spent
true